

Sector Connector Network Group is a monthly online convening for adult education providers, workforce partners, and employers to strengthen sector partnerships and align education-to-employment pathways across Colorado.
Participants collaborate to share practices and coordinate strategies that support adult learners moving into training, college, apprenticeships, and employment.
The group meets online the third Friday of each month from 10:00–11:00 a.m. to share updates, build connections, and strengthen workforce-aligned adult education across Colorado.

An aging workforce is increasing retirements across healthcare, construction, utilities, and manufacturing.
Many communities struggle to recruit workers because of housing shortages, transportation barriers, and limited access to training.
Adult learners often need foundational education, digital literacy, English language instruction, or a high school equivalency before entering career pathways.
77% of Colorado's Top Jobs require a postsecondary credential or training.
